Simplifying 4x + -6 = x + -6 Reorder the terms: -6 + 4x = x + -6 Reorder the terms: -6 + 4x = -6 + x Add '6' to each side of the equation. -6 + 6 + 4x = -6 + 6 + x Combine like terms: -6 + 6 = 0 0 + 4x = -6 + 6 + x 4x = -6 + 6 + x Combine like terms: -6 + 6 = 0 4x = 0 + x 4x = x Solving 4x = x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1x' to each side of the equation. 4x + -1x = x + -1x Combine like terms: 4x + -1x = 3x 3x = x + -1x Combine like terms: x + -1x = 0 3x = 0 Divide each side by '3'. x = 0 Simplifying x = 0
